third person

IT WAS DECIDED THAT Liam, Sheriff, and Luna return to the Sheriff station where Theo was.  Stilinski wants to get ahold of his deputies, but Liam is going to argue the fact that they could use Theo.  Liam's riding with Luna as Stilinski takes his own car.  When she pulls into the parking lot of the station and shuts the engine off, she stops Liam from getting out.  Luna had told the Sheriff that she'd needed to speak with Liam when they got there, so he's sitting in his car waiting.

"Hey, Liam.  I need to talk to you," Luna says.  He'd already started to get out, but at the sound of her voice he only leaves the door cracked.

Liam asks, "Right now?  The Ghost Riders could be coming any minute now."

Knowing Theo is probably listening in after hearing her truck's loud engine pull in and park, Luna tells him, "It shouldn't take but a minute.  I want to tell you about the news Charlie gave me."

Liam shuts the door of the truck to listen to her.  The news has been plaguing her for a couple of weeks, and Liam knows it's something very serious to do with her family.  Luna was right about Theo.  The moment Theo heard her truck coming down the road, he began using his werewolf hearing to listen to her.  He couldn't help but think she is only talking about this with Liam because she wants him to hear it.

Liam says cautiously, "Okay, but you don't have to if you don't want to."

"No," Luna stops him.  "I do.  I need to.  If Corey hadn't been taken, I'd tell him, too.  You're my best friends and you guys deserve to know."  Liam nods and waits patiently for her to speak again.  "You know, I have a little sister, right?  Rosa?  A couple of months ago, around the same time Stiles was taken, she tried making her way to Beacon Hills."  The same confused look she'd gotten when she heard that part of the news is on Liam's face.  "She tried to hitchhike with semi-drivers, but she only made it to the next town over.  It took them a couple of days, but my werewolf brothers and my dad were able to track her body in the middle of a desert."  Luna's voice starts to shake as she begins to think of all the things that could've been done to her before the trucker left her in the desert.  "She was naked and half-buried under the sand.  They couldn't tell it was her from her face, but scent doesn't lie.  Even if it did, they got her fingerprints checked and DNA definitely does not."

"Oh, Luna—" Liam goes to hug her but puts her hands out to stop him.

She says, "Please, don't hug me.  I'm surprisingly keeping the tears at bay, but if you hug me there won't be any stopping them."

Liam understands and settles with apologizing, "I'm so sorry, Luna.  Did they catch the guy who did it?"

Luna shakes her head and says, for Theo's sake, "No, they couldn't track his scent so they gave up."

Theo, while Luna is able to keep her tears back, lets his tears fall freely down his face.  Luna wasn't the only one he was close with.  He'd been friends with Asher, and he joined in on picking on Rosa whenever the three of them were in the mood to.  She was like a little sister to him and always sang the K-I-S-S-I-N-G song whenever he was around Luna.  When he hears the sound of car doors closing, he wipes his tears away and is left with a small pit of anger in his gut.

Liam and Luna follow Stilinski into the Sheriff station and Liam's trying to plead his case about Theo.

"Look," he says, "I'm not saying you have to like him.  I'm just saying maybe he can help us."

"Liam," Stilinski says over his shoulders as he leads the two of us to where all of the Deputy desks are sitting.  "I'll consider asking Theo for help when I don't have a station full of armed deputies to back me up."

The three of them step into the room and find a mess of leaves, papers, and overturned desk lamps with zero deputies working to clean it up.  There's a radio buzzing from the floor and the Sheriff walks over to fiddle with the knobs.  Liam and Luna share a weary glance but go to stand near the Sheriff anyway.

Stilinski calls out over the radio, "Any available units, this is Sheriff Stilinski.  Do you copy?"  When all he gets back is radio static, he tries another channel.  "I repeat, any and all units, this is Sheriff Stilinski.  Respond immediately with your 20."

All he gets is static and Luna and Liam share another glance as Stilinski goes to repeat himself.

"They're gone," Liam interrupts him.  Stilinski stops to look at the two.

Luna says, "I'm sorry, Sheriff.  None of them are left except for Parrish and Douglas is using him as a lap dog."

"That—That's not possible.  That's—"  The older man gets to his feet and says, "They couldn't have taken everyone."

Luna's heart jumps as she hears Theo's voice state, "They didn't."

Liam glances at her, having heard the change in heartbeat, before turning back to the Sheriff.  The two guys turn the heads while Luna shuffles around Liam to stare at the boy behind bars.  Stilinski sighs as he leads the two over to the cells.  For a few minutes, the three stare in at Theo making him anxious.

"Please, please tell me that you brought the key card," Theo says.

Stilinski counters, "I also brought my gun."

"And your sense of humor," Theo states.  "That is great.  But if we're the only ones left in Beacon Hills, then we need each other.  Which means you need me out of this cell."

"We need to trust you," Liam tells him.

"Then you need to get realistic, because trust is not important right now.  Alright?"  Theo turns to every person, holding their stare, Luna's more than the others.  "It is us against them.  And you want a lot more of us considering how many of them there are."

"I hate to say he's right but—"

"Story of my life," Luna mutters when Liam pauses.

"He's kind of right."

Stilinski thinks for a moment before saying, "If I let you out and I see any behavior that I find remotely suspicious, I'll put so many bullets in your head, God won't even recognize you."

"I'm an atheist.  Fire at will."

Luna gulps as her gaze shifts from Theo to Stilinski.  The older of the two lifts the key card out of his pocket and toys with it near the scanner.

"You're going to need to be a lot closer than that, Sheriff.  Wave it over the card reader, come on.  Right here."  Theo pats the scanner.  "Up and down.  You can do it."

"He's not a fucking dog, Theo," Luna blurts out harshly.

Theo glares at her but he's not angry with her.  He just wants out of the cell with a fair chance at fighting.

"Sheriff, we need him," Liam states.

Only a few seconds pass before Theo tries reaching through the bars to grab the key card.  Luna sighs and rolls her eyes when his poorly thought out plan isn't successful.

"Tell me something," Stilinski demands.

Theo's confused, "What?  Tell you what?  What are you talking about?"

Liam and Luna can hear the wind blowing which is the start of the Ghost Rider's presence.

"Tell me about my son.  Tell me one thing about Stiles that you remember.  Just one."

"You swipe that key card, I'll tell you anything you want."

"Sheriff," Liam says, the sound of thunder echos overhead.  "They are coming."

But Sheriff is not backing down and repeats, "One thing.  Just one thing!"

Theo grunts and yanks at the bars.  Stilinski starts to walk away from him.  Luna quickly glances between Theo and Stilinski, subconsciously panicking.

"He was smart!"  Theo stops the Sheriff from leaving.  When he turns around, Theo lowers his voice.  "He was smart enough not to trust me."

It's all the Sheriff needed to swipe the card and let him out.  Theo hurries out of the cell before any of them could change their minds and lock him back inside.  His eyes lock on Luna's, wanting to finish what he was trying to tell her earlier, but the Sheriff is already leaving the room and Luna is following after him.  In a straight line, Liam follows behind Stilinski while Luna follows Liam and Theo takes up the rear.  Thunder rumbles, wind whistles, and horses neigh.  Theo steps around Liam and Luna to stand next to Stilinski, and Luna steps forward to stand next to Liam.

"They're here," Liam announces.

Stilinski asks while pulling out his gun, "How close?"

The three werewolves listen to the steps each Ghost Rider were taken.

"Too close," Theo answers.

"How many?"

Liam says, "I heard a couple horses.  Maybe more."

"I think there's four, maybe more," Luna tells them.

"Five.  I—I think five at most," Theo infers.

Stilinski says, "Four of us.  Five of them.  You ready?"

"Luna can take on five by herself, I'm more than ready," Liam states.

Luna shakes her head and says, "I'm not shifting.  I'm not ready to do that again."

"What do you mean?  Luna, it's us or them.  You're the big guns," Liam tries to convince her.

"I don't like how it made me feel, Liam.  I don't care if it was self-defense," Luna tells him.

Stilinski moves forward after cocking his gun and Theo stops him and asks, "Wait, are you kidding?  You heard Luna, she doesn't want to do it.  Us against five Ghost Riders?"

"We can still take 'em," Liam declares.

Theo's still against it, "Five of them?"

"Four of us."

"Yeah, I'll still use as much of my strength I can.  We'll be able to take them," Luna explains to Theo.

"Yeah," Stilinski mutters before leading them to the door.  The werewolves flick out their claws as the Sheriff opens the door.  They're faced with more than five Ghost Riders.

"Oh, fuck," Luna blurts.  Stilinski grunts as the Ghost Rider's lift their guns to point straight at him before shooting.  The puff of green smoke erupted in front of Luna and the three teenagers jump on either side of the doorway.  The Ghost Riders keep shooting until they can't see the kids.  Luna and Theo stare at each other across the space of the doorway before Luna reaches over and grabs his wrist to pull him to her side.

"Three of us," Theo tells Liam and Luna.  Liam nods and leads the two away from the Ghost Riders in the other room.

"Luna, do you still have the keys to your truck?" Liam shouts over his shoulder.

Luna's fly to her pockets, but doesn't find them anywhere.

"No, no, no!  I must've dropped them!"

Liam stops to rip a box full of keys off of the wall as Theo keeps running towards the exit.  Luna pauses for only a second to wait for Liam before they both catch up to Theo outside.  They glance around to find a vehicle that's not blocked in the parking lot and find one of the cars near the exit.  Theo gets in the driver seat while Liam lets Luna in from the passenger where she shoves her body over to sit on the console as he gets to sit in the passenger seat.  If she'd gotten in the back one of the two would've had to let her out when they'd gotten to their destination and they wanted it to be quick and easy in case the Ghost Riders had them surrounded.

"Keys, keys!" Theo demands from Liam.  Liam opens the box he'd ripped off the wall inside and finds a bunch of different keys inside.  The three of them glance at each other.  "Are you serious?"

Liam grabs a key and hands it to Theo while saying, "Here."

Theo tries to put the key into the ignition but it doesn't fit.

"Give me another," Theo tells him.

"Which one?"

"Any of them.  Come on!"

"There's a lot of keys here!"

Luna studies the keys as the two of them bicker on which key will work.  Theo tries another key and groans angrily when it doesn't work.

"I really feel like you're not even trying right now, Liam," Theo shouts as Liam grabs another key.

Liam lets out a small scream after saying, "I'm trying."

Another one doesn't work and Liam hands him another key out of pure panic.  The key he hands Theo is much smaller and clearly wouldn't fit in the ignition.

"This isn't even a car key!"

Luna reaches out and grabs a key from the box, handing it Theo.

"Here.  It's this one," she states.  Theo puts it in the ignition, and the vehicle starts right up.

"Whoa!  Yes!  Go, go, go!"  Liam hits his hands on the dashboard, urging Theo to start driving.

Theo shifts the car into gear and hits the gas, backing up into the group of Ghost Riders that were starting to surround them.  Theo and Liam share a look with a smile on their faces as Luna stares ahead, waiting for him to drive forward.  Once he does, Liam tells him which roads to take.

Theo asks Luna, "How'd you know which key it was?"

Luna laughs, "The keys are labelled, smartass.  The number on the outside of the car is 95 so I just looked for the key that had the number on it.  I didn't just completely panic and grab random keys like some people."

Luna turns her head so she's staring directly at Liam.

"Hey, in my defense, Theo was yelling at me."

"Yeah, because you were handing me keys that wouldn't even fit in a car ignition!"

"Because you were yelling at me!"

"Guys!" Luna interrupts their bickering.  "It's okay.  We're out of there now.  We found the key.  We're good."

Theo shakes his head as he drives down an empty road.

"Where does this take us?" Theo asks.

Liam answers, "The hospital."

"Hospital?  Why the—What the hell are we supposed to do at the hospital?"

"Hide.  Look, we can't outrun them, right?  I know every inch of that building.  Every room, every corner."

"Hide, that's the best that we've got?"

"We just need to keep them away from Scott for as long as possible."

"Why?  What's he gonna do?"

"He's gonna remember."

"Remember what?"

"Stiles," Luna interjects.  "He has to remember everything about Stiles.  When Stilinski remembered, he created a rift and saw him.  If Scott or Malia or Lydia can do it, they can get him back.  I remembered him, but I wasn't as close to him as they were.  If it were you we had to remember, it'd be a different story."

"What if he can't?" Theo questions.

Liam replies, "Then the rest of us.  We get forgotten."
